Update.
I stripped the interior of my car out to see what was lurking in those arches.
Took me AGES to figure out how to get the seats out but got there in the end with a little help !
So the drivers side isnt too bad i guess.

Under my spare wheel i did find a massive dead wasp.
Little shot of the rust around the window
![Image](http://sphotos.ak.fbcdn.net/hphotos-ak-snc3/hs592.snc3/31205_396902969018_724619018_3977068_5374377_n.jpg)
Its about the same on the other side
This is how the passenger side looks from the outside. Its gonna worse and worse over the few months its been stood about.

And the inside...
![Image](http://sphotos.ak.fbcdn.net/hphotos-ak-snc3/hs572.snc3/31205_396905749018_724619018_3977148_1211967_n.jpg)
Some body has welded a patch in previously. I am unsure how they have managed it but i think they have welded it from the inside. All those little sticks you can see sticking up are the stick welds. They havent even been cut down or anything and there everywere. That full patch needs cutting out
Down in the sill region some one has stuffed it full of newspaper!
